Rustic Cafe:
Lunch on Sunday 29th May
2 x large beers
1 'tapas tile' to share: Jamon, Croquets, padron peppers, squid, meatballs, chicken wings, quiche, tortilla, couscous with chickpeas, bread & Olives
2 x caramel vodka on the house
Around €30

Only visited here on the ruta before - lovely food & service. Excellent value - v. large portion size (suspect the menu may have said the ‘tapas tile’ serves 2-3) was quite a lot for lunch.
Also, our 1st time drinking caramel vodka ..... probably won't be the last but not sure I could trust myself to buy a bottle!

La Celtika:
Dinner Thursday 26th May
Okay, this is a big one. I think we’ve done a reasonable job of remembering most of the details (particularly as there was alcohol involved) but hopefully LaCeltika sees this & can update if we’ve missed anything important:

2 x Kir Royale
2 x Tasting Menu with matching wines:

Round 1: Amuse Bouche of Artichoke with tomato marmalade / Tapenade & a cheese crisp
Round 2: A celebration of peas: Pea soup, with pea puree, pea shoots, pea salt & peas plus a perfect poached egg.
Round 3: Marinated Sea Bass, Beetroot, Asparagus, Octopus + Beetroot & Asparagus purees
Round 4: John Dory, Lentils & tarragon 'horseradish' served with a john dory stock. (All the dishes were stunning but we both agreed this was our favourite
Round 5: Dessert of Mango Sorbet, Fresh Mango, Mango & passion fruit coulis, Chantilly cream & meringue.
Wines were all white: Gomariz, Butxet & Tianna Bocchoris.
To finish : 2 x Brandy (Montenego) & 2 x lemon macarons

Cost €50 per tasting menu + €20 for matching wines + €extra for Kir Royale & Brandy
The most expensive dinner of the holiday but still fantastic value for money for the standard of cooking, ingredients & service (especially when compared to what you would pay in the UK for something similar).
The chef/owner, Yann only uses the best ingredients, cooks & presents the dishes perfectly - if it's not too warm I'd recommend sitting inside so you get to watch Yann at work and interact with him throughout the meal.
Currently they are only doing the tasting menu and the details of the menu aren't listed as it can vary daily because Yann is focussed on using local ingredients & adjusts the menu depending on what is available / in season.
Given the price and the lack of detail I think some people may be but off going in but, having eaten here on previous holidays we had no such concerns -
If you enjoy high-end dining then I can't recommend this restaurant highly enough & if you have any concerns about the lack of detail on the menu pop into the restaurant and I'm sure they'll be happy to provide more info.
Hopefully we still have another holiday in PP later this year so I won’t be voting for my top 5 restaurants just yet – but I’d be very surprised if we will find anywhere to top this (& we will definitely be back for another meal if when we next come back to PP).
